Abstract
The invention discloses a feeding method for increasing postweaning estrus rate of first-farrowing sows and belongs to the technical field of livestock breeding. The feeding method for increasing postweaning estrus rate of first-farrowing sows is characterized in that feeding amount of the first-farrowing sows in lactation is changed, feeding amount of daily ration from the first day to the seventh day of lactation is 1.5kg+0.5kg* number of piglets, feeding amount of daily ration from the eighth day to the twenty-first day of lactation is (1.5kg+0.5kg*number of piglets)*140%, feeding amount of daily ration from the twenty-second day to twenty-eighth day is (1.5kg+0.5kg*number of piglets)*120%, the feeding amount of daily ration after weaning is restored to 1.5kg+0.5kg*number of piglets, and nutrition level per unit feed in feeding accords to pig nutrients requirements of American NRC (national research council) (1998). By the feeding method compared with conventional feeding methods, the postweaning estrus rate of the first-farrowing sows is increased by 15%-20%. The feeding method provides reliable and specific experimental basis for increasing the postweaning estrus rate of the first-farrowing sows, and has important theoretical value and broad application prospect in improving reproductive capacity of the first-farrowing sows.

Background technology
In the Swine Production, first farrowing sow all occupies suitable vast scale (20%~30%) on commodity field and kind pig farm, and its fertility height is very big to full crowd's influence.Under the normal condition, 85%~90% multiparity sow oestruses in wean performance in back 7 days, and the first farrowing sow rate of oestrusing is merely 60%~70%.Because most of first farrowing sows are not accomplished as yet and self grown, gestation intermediary and later stages fetus grows rapidly and lactation in postpartum lot of consumption, very easily causes the nutrition negative balance.First farrowing sow loses too much body weight and has a strong impact on its lactation amount and reproductive performance subsequently, and comprising weans to inter oestrual period prolongs conception rate, survival rate reduction etc.Therefore, the present invention is significant to research raising first farrowing sow postweaning estrus rate.

Technical scheme
For realizing above-mentioned purpose, the invention provides a kind of like this raising method, it adopts the first farrowing sow lactation to begin to increase scale of feeding on the 8th day, continues to wean, returns to scale of feeding 1.5kg+0.5kg commonly used * piglet number after the wean.
Be that the 1st day to the 7th day daily ration of lactation fed by scale of feeding 1.5kg+0.5kg commonly used * piglet number; The 8th day to the 21st day daily ration of lactation is that benchmark increases mass ratio 40% with scale of feeding 1.5kg+0.5kg commonly used * piglet number; The 22nd day to the 28th day daily ration of lactation is that benchmark increases mass ratio 20% with scale of feeding 1.5kg+0.5kg commonly used * piglet number, returns to scale of feeding 1.5kg+0.5kg commonly used * piglet number after the wean.
Between lactation period, change first farrowing sow daily ration scale of feeding, unit feed nutrition level is with reference to the nutritional need of U.S. NRC pig, and the trophic level of per kilogram daily ration is following:
Nutrition content
Metabolic energy, MJ/Kg 12-14
Crude protein, mass ratio % 15-18
Lysine, mass ratio % 0.8-1.0
Egg+cystine, mass ratio % 0.3-0.5
Threonine, mass ratio % 0.5-0.7
Tryptophan, mass ratio % 0.1-0.2
Calcium, mass ratio % 0.6-0.8
Phosphorus, mass ratio % 0.5-0.8
Vitamin ++
Trace element ++.
Beneficial effect
Because the present invention increases the feed scale of feeding at first farrowing sow between lactation period, reduce the body weight loss that causes because of lactation, change reproductive hormone secretion level in the first farrowing sow body, to compare with raising method commonly used, first farrowing sow postweaning estrus rate can improve 15%~20%.Simultaneously, change during the feed scale of feeding, other unit feed nutrition level is constant, and next tire number of eggs ovulated of first farrowing sow, fetus survival rate and litter size are compared with raising method commonly used and significantly improved, and improve next tire reproductive performance of first farrowing sow.

Embodiment
As shown in Figure 1, the 1st day to the 7th day scale of feeding commonly used of feeding of first farrowing sow (236) lactation, lactation began to increase scale of feeding on the 8th day, continued to wean, returned to scale of feeding 1.5kg+0.5kg commonly used * piglet number after the wean.
It is the lactation daily ration 1.5kg+0.5kg * piglet number of feeding the 1st day to the 7th day every day; The lactation daily ration (1.5kg+0.5kg * piglet number) * 140% of feeding the 8th day to the 21st day every day; The lactation daily ration (1.5kg+0.5kg * piglet number) * 120% of feeding the 22nd day to the 28th day every day returns to the daily ration 1.5kg+0.5kg * piglet number of feeding every day after the wean.Sow wean in 28 days, between feed period, scale of feeding changes, and unit feed nutrition level is with reference to the nutritional need (1998) (seeing table 1) of U.S. NRC pig, and first farrowing sow scale of feeding every day lactation period is seen table 2.
Implementation result: see Fig. 2.
Adopt raising method of the present invention, first farrowing sow wean back can occur oestrusing on the 3rd day, and the 7th day rate of oestrusing in wean back can reach 80%; The 10th day rate of oestrusing in wean back can reach 85%; Compare with raising method commonly used, the rate of oestrusing improves 15%~20%, does sth. in advance 1-2 days estrus time.
The trophic level of table 1 first farrowing sow per kilogram lactation period daily ration (with reference to the nutritional need (1998) of U.S. NRC pig)
Nutrition | Content |
Metabolic energy, MJ/Kg | 13.19 |
Crude protein, % | 17.10 |
Lysine (capable of using), % | 0.9 (0.73) |
Egg+cystine (capable of using), % | 0.44 (0.36) |
Threonine (capable of using), % | 0.58 (0.43) |
Tryptophan (capable of using), % | 0.17 (0.13) |
Calcium, % | 0.75 |
Phosphorus, % | 0.60 |
Vitamin | ++ |
Trace element | ++ |
